然而,对于大型的BPEL过程,人为检测差异是一项相当沉闷、耗时和容易出错的工作。在没有修改日志可以使用的前提下,一种最简单的方法就是找出所有被更改的元素,用修改操作原语将差异展示出来。但对于用户而言,修改操作原语和BPEL过程元素间的关系不易被确定,且相当繁琐,因此它们难以被处理。于是,为了提供一种易于用户理解和掌握的方法检测和解决BPEL过程之间的差异,我们的解决方案应该满足以下几点要求:(1)解决方案必须能够重建修改日志,呈现出BPEL过程之间转换的详细修改步骤;(2)为了提高用户可用性,BPEL过程之间的差异应该被分类,并和它们发生的区域联系起来;(3)解决方案必须确保用户能够应用复合修改操作来解决差异,而不是通过修改操作原语修改每一个需要被更改的元素;(4)解决方案能够让用户自主选择一些修改操作,并且以他们需要的修改顺序来完成这些操作。
上一篇:基于METRIC模型的备件库存优化算法研究与实现
下一篇:ASP+access教师信息管理系统设计+文献综述

复合通信网络上信息传输过程研究

基于核独立元分析的非线...

基于Hadoop的制造过程大数据存储平台构建

基于Agent的突发事件中网络...

delta3D电解铝生产过程三维仿真技术

基于网络模拟电话呼叫处理过程

MATLAB酯化釜温度过程建模及控制算法的研究

公寓空调设计任务书

医院财务风险因素分析及管理措施【2367字】

AT89C52单片机的超声波测距...

10万元能开儿童乐园吗,我...

神经外科重症监护病房患...

国内外图像分割技术研究现状

中国学术生态细节考察《...

承德市事业单位档案管理...

志愿者活动的调查问卷表

C#学校科研管理系统的设计